Cannonville Town Council Meeting Minutes
AUGUST 2026
Cannonville town held their regular Monthly Board Meeting Wednesday, August 19th, 2026, in the town Hall. The meeting began at 7:00pm.

Mayor's Items: Mayor Scoffield welcomed everybody to the August 2026 meeting. He was looking forward to the annual audit Friday August 21st. He reviewed how the audits become more specific and detailed when revenues and expenditures exceed a $1M.
Mayor Scoffield commented that he hadn't heard anything new from SITLA. He highlighted plans for another AM250 celebration September 19th honoring and remembering 'Constitution Day.' Program to include Betsy Ross, line dancing and food. He then spent some time talking about the state and regional work being done on hazard and emergency mitigation plans. The ongoing meetings can be reviewed on the five counties and state's websites
Departmental Reports:
Planning: Mr. Pete Jensen was excused; nothing to report about town projects.
Water: Mr. Alma Fletcher reported the airline to the bottom of the well had been activated and was giving good depth readings. Always beneficial in managing the well. He talked about the 'cone of depression' and how it takes a couple of hours for the water to refill the sandstone cavity around the pump. The work with installation of SCADA controls is on track.
Fire: Stewart invited folks to attend another training session to be scheduled in the next couple of weeks. Stacie and Bailey Mathews, Melanie Muir, Rob Mathews, and Brandon Ott are interested in helping and training. The Henrieville Fire Chief, McKinley Nez then thanked the town for funding updated head protection gear for the Henrieville fire dept. They have always responded to Cannonville fires.
Parks: Mr. Davis Kendrick indicated he was working with Mr. Carter Mortensen on some additional electrical work in the park kitchen and the stage.
Roads: Landyn Brinkerhoff reported some of the street signs have been installed. He had a concern about the Kodachrome Road sign. More info to come.
Public: Mr. Eric Gamboni, freelance mural artist working for Clear Skies, again outlined his interest in putting some of his work on the south facing side of the south tank. He passed around examples.
